9 Humility and Service  “Seraphim stood above Him”  Only use in Bible – means burning ones  Two wings cover faces – can’t see God’s glory and live – indicates reverence and humility  Two wings cover feet – indicates their lowliness and even shame if the Holy God sees them  Two wings they flew – indicates immediate and constant service A Visionary Statement John 12:41

10 Humility and Service  The verbs used here – cover and flew – are continuous action items – never ceasing  Notice that there are four wings relating to God and two relating to serving Him  This provides us a pattern for service:  Reverence and humility  Lowliness – an understanding of who you are not  Which all lead to service  Shows resources at God’s disposal – 2 Kings 6:15-19 A Visionary Statement John 12:41

13 Holy, Holy, Holy  Isaiah notices true worship in the Seraphim  Holy repeated three times is important  Repetition is used for emphasis – pit or pit, pit  Isaiah 26:3 is an example using “peace” A Visionary Statement John 12:41

14 Isaiah 26:3 (NASB) 3 “The steadfast of mind You will keep in perfect peace, Because he trusts in You.

15 Holy, Holy, Holy  Isaiah notices true worship in the Seraphim  Holy repeated three times is important  Repetition is used for emphasis – pit or pit, pit  Isaiah 26:3 is an example using “peace”  Nowhere in Scripture is this device used 3x  Notice also endless repetition  Temple foundation shakes and smoke protects A Visionary Statement John 12:41

16 Isaiah’s Commission  First – Isaiah caught a vision of God and His Holiness  Second – Isaiah saw himself for who he was in relationship to this Holy God  Third – Isaiah had a vision of service to this Holy God and what part he should play in his response to all of this A Visionary Statement John 12:41
